The Sea-Doo GTX Limited RXT 215 starter solenoid cable is an essential component of the ignition system for select Sea-Doo watercraft models from the 2003-2009 era, including the 278002265 and 278001802 variants. This cable plays a vital role in the starting process by providing power to the starter motor from the battery when the ignition key is turned.
